New Orleans Saints tight end Adam Trautman will most likely be getting the first-team reps at the position Sunday in the team's Week 4 game against the Detroit Lions.
Usual starter Jared Cook is missing the game with a groin issue, paving the way for the Dayton product to make his first career start. The team is showing confidence in Trautman's ability to fill Cook's shoes, so fantasy owners should be as well. With Michael Thomas still out, targets are there for the taking.
Our models currently project Trautman for 1.5 catches, 15.7 receiving yards, 0.1 touchdowns and 3.1 FanDuel points.
